FT-203 Clay
Description: Westerwald, Germany - Plastic Clay
| Oxide | Analysis | Formula | Tolerance |
|---|---|---|---|
| CaO | 0.19% | 0.01 | |
| K2O | 2.69% | 0.12 | |
| MgO | 0.28% | 0.03 | |
| Na2O | 0.09% | 0.01 | |
| TiO2 | 1.21% | 0.06 | |
| Al2O3 | 24.10% | 1.00 | |
| SiO2 | 61.83% | 4.35 | |
| Fe2O3 | 2.13% | 0.06 | |
| LOI | 7.40% | n/a | |
| C | 0.09% | n/a | |
| Oxide Weight | 391.52 | ||
| Formula Weight | 423.24 | ||
Notes
Raw Color - CREAM
Particle Size (e.s.d.)
125 microns - 0.5
63 microns - 0.9
20 microns - 95
2 microns - 78
.5 microns - 57
Modulus of Rupture at 110C
Mn/M2 - 5.1
lbf/in2 - 850
Water Absorption
1120C - 1.0
1220C - 1.00
Shrinkage Dry to Fired
1120C - 11.0
1220C - 11.0
Refractoriness
Cone - 30, 1670C
Plastic Index - 836
PF NO. - 35.9

Clay Other
Clays that are not kaolins, ball clays or bentonites. For example, stoneware clays are mixtures of all of the above plus quartz, feldspar, mica and other minerals. There are also many clays that have high plasticity like bentonite but are much different mineralogically. |
